c'est vrai je me suis rendu compte grâce à ta vidéo qu'aujourd'hui à cause des frameworks et tout les outils de ce genre, on utilise vraiment très peu le potentiel réel des SGBD . On essaye de tout gérer au niveau du code exécuté coté serveur, et le travail du SGBD se réduit uniquement à exécuter les requêtes, quel gaspillage . Je vais me pencher sur cette logique, c'est très intéressant. vive la paresse des codeurs !!!!
21:30 Concernant le versionnement des APIs, sachant que dans nos schémas public (v1, v2, etc...) nous n'avons que des vues et fonctions pointant vers les schémas privés, comment peut-on faire si on veut dire "ok je développe la prochaine version, je nettoie la BDD, j'enlève telle colonne, je modifie le nom d'une autre colonne, etc..." sans que ça pète au niveau des schéma publics précédents ? Parce que si demain, mes application clientes utilisant des données issuent de colonnes qui n'existent plus ou dont le nom a été modifié continuent à fetch tranquillement, va y avoir collision... Je ne vois vraiment pas comment gérer ces situations (encore l'évolution d'API qui ne fait que rajouter du contenu par dessus oui mais là non)
c'est vrai je me suis rendu compte grâce à ta vidéo qu'aujourd'hui à cause des frameworks et tout les outils de ce genre, on utilise vraiment très peu le potentiel réel des SGBD . On essaye de tout gérer au niveau du code exécuté coté serveur, et le travail du SGBD se réduit uniquement à exécuter les requêtes, quel gaspillage . Je vais me pencher sur cette logique, c'est très intéressant. vive la paresse des codeurs !!!!
super video ! Merci
Epic!
21:30 Concernant le versionnement des APIs, sachant que dans nos schémas public (v1, v2, etc...) nous n'avons que des vues et fonctions pointant vers les schémas privés, comment peut-on faire si on veut dire "ok je développe la prochaine version, je nettoie la BDD, j'enlève telle colonne, je modifie le nom d'une autre colonne, etc..." sans que ça pète au niveau des schéma publics précédents ? Parce que si demain, mes application clientes utilisant des données issuent de colonnes qui n'existent plus ou dont le nom a été modifié continuent à fetch tranquillement, va y avoir collision... Je ne vois vraiment pas comment gérer ces situations (encore l'évolution d'API qui ne fait que rajouter du contenu par dessus oui mais là non)
08:27 graphQL a encore plein de problemes
les manettes